As the weather gets warmer and the season begins to change over it’s time to start planning for the spring season. With projects beginning in a few short weeks, there is no better time to perform routine maintenance and repairs on your equipment to prepare for the busy spring and summer seasons.
Winter brings about long periods of disuse and cold temperatures that affect heavy construction and road maintenance equipment in different ways. From damaged parts to pest infestation, anything can happen!
